List of Accredited Online Universities in USA for International Students
An accredited online university issues a degree that is valid and recognized by employers. It’s important to know why accreditation matters, so students don’t waste their time and money studying from a university that does not give them career insurance.
- It ensures that the degree is recognized by the academic committee and the employer.
- It shows that you got high quality education from a reputable institution.
- Gives a degree that works globally.
Accredited Online Universities
Here is a list of accredited online universities in USA for international students to help them make the right choice.
College/University Name | Notable Online Programs |
University of Florida | Business, Engineering, Health |
Arizona State University | Innovation, Psychology, IT |
Purdue Global | Nursing, Public Safety, Business |
Liberty University | Education, Counseling, Divinity |
University of Maryland Global Campus | Cybersecurity, Data Analytics |

Cheapest Online University in USA
While considering taking admission, cost is the biggest deciding factor for many students. When students choose the cheapest online university in USA, it can save them from lots of debt and make education affordable within the student’s budget.
Budget-Friendly Online Universities
- Western Governors University (WGU): affordable fee per semester.
- Southern New Hampshire University (SNHU): Affordable and flexible programs.
- St. Petersburg College: Low-cost state-supported online degrees.

Which US University Gives 100% Scholarships?
It is not possible that a university gives 100% scholarships to all the students. But some students can get full funding if they meet the specific requirements and conditions of the program.
US universities known for full or near full scholarships:
- Harvard University offers need-based financial aid that can cover full tuition and living costs.
- Yale University provides full need-based aid for eligible domestic and international students.
- Princeton University covers all the proven financial needs without any loans.
- MIT offers full scholarships for students from low-income backgrounds.
- Stanford University also provides generous aid packages that can reach full coverage.
